The City of Seattle is now accepting nominations for the annual Mayor's Small Business Awards. Ten small businesses around Seattle will be selected to receive an awarded based on excellence in management, entrepreneurial spirit, customer service and community involvement. 2007 marks the 23rd year of the program, which has recognized more than 220 small businesses.

Last year, the city recognized BizXchange, Great Dog, Marjorie and Second Use Building Materials Inc.
